Jackie Speier: Sexual Assault in the Military
If military commanders sacrifice justice for the good of the mission, then what are we fighting for?
2016-03-01 | 11 minutes
Plot Summary
Congresswoman Jackie Speier explains her approach to protecting victims of sexual assault within the military. Her goal is to take prosecuting powers out of the inner ranks and put it into the hands of properly trained detectives.
